Use type suffix to avoid warnings
When compiling with all warnings enabled, some defines can lead to warning due to missing unsigned type suffix: warning: integer overflow in expression [-Woverflow] This fix should not affected behavior at all, since calculation with such overflows lead to the same actual address when writing to that location. However, it makes the warning disappear and also defines the right data type for a memory location.
